Output ddbdbad42fd44d74cb913d75ee6cd144edec71e7ccddf7d9cdb05f42ca25d7c4:6

value
1011342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4972f68cedbb54d95e5f1f180ff1f10d447a024e OP_EQUAL
address
38PNyKg1PvwxvQYtkDwGBb9SNCCjn4GooD
transaction
ddbdbad42fd44d74cb913d75ee6cd144edec71e7ccddf7d9cdb05f42ca25d7c4
confirmations
315024
spent
true